Eddie MacKenzie (Charlottetown, PEI) is set to play MacKenzie in the Final MacKenzie advanced directly to the championship game after finishing first in the preliminary round. of the PEI Tankard, held January 4 - 7, 2018 at the Charlottetown Curling Club in Charlottetown, Canada. To advance to the championship game, MacKenzie won 12-4 over John Likely (Charlottetown, PEI) in the semifinals of the 2018 PEI Tankard in Charlottetown, Prince Edward Island, Canada;
 
MacKenzie finished 5-1 in the 5-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, MacKenzie defeated Likely 10-9, then won 9-3 against Tyler Harris (Charlottetown, PEI) and 10-7 against Phil Gorveatt (Charlottetown, PEI). MacKenzie went on to lose 10-8 against Likely. MacKenzie responded with a 7-4 win over Harris. MacKenzie won 7-2 against Likely in their final qualifying round match.
 
For winning the PEI Tankard Championship title, MacKenzie earned 2.625 world rankings points, moving up 39 spots the World Ranking Standings into 342nd place overall with 6.069 total points. MacKenzie ranks 294th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 2.625 points earned so far this season.
